Absolutely! While having a custom-built website is often suggested for affiliate advertising success, it’s definitely not a prerequisite. It's perfectly possible to generate affiliate earnings through other avenues. Social media platforms like Twitter offer significant reach, and you can leverage them to distribute your affiliate links. Similarly, email advertising, while requiring a little more setup, can be incredibly effective. Building an email list allows you to directly connect potential customers and nurture them with relevant offers. Content creation on platforms like YouTube or Medium can also drive traffic to your affiliate links—just ensure you're adhering to each platform's guidelines regarding affiliate marketing. The key is to find a alternative approach and consistently provide value to your audience without relying on a traditional website. Yet, always keep platform rules in mind.
